Dialight 5510507 LED Circuit Board Indicator - Equivalent & Substitute Parts

Part Overview

The Dialight 5510507 is a 3mm red LED circuit board indicator designed for 5V applications with 10mA current consumption. This component features a diffused, tinted lens with a round domed top and is configured for through-hole, right-angle mounting on PCBs. The part is classified as obsolete, making identification of suitable substitutes essential for ongoing production and maintenance applications. Active equivalent and similar alternatives are available from both the original manufacturer and qualified suppliers.

Substitute Part Grouping Explanation

Substitution for the Dialight 5510507 is determined by strict alignment of the following critical parameters:

Direct Manufacturer Equivalent: The Dialight 5510507F is the active production equivalent from the original manufacturer. This part maintains identical electrical specifications (5V, 10mA, 635nm peak wavelength, 29mcd brightness, 60° viewing angle) and mechanical form factor (3mm T-1 through-hole, right-angle mount, diffused tinted lens with domed top). The primary difference is product status (active vs. obsolete) and packaging format (bulk vs. standard). This part is ROHS3 compliant and carries the same regulatory certifications.

Similar Manufacturer Alternative: The Lumex Opto/Components Inc. SSF-LXH103ID-5V provides functional equivalence with specified parameter variations. This part shares the same voltage rating (5V), form factor (3mm T-1 through-hole, right-angle mount), lens type (diffused, tinted, round domed top), and wavelength (635nm). Electrical differences include current consumption (12mA vs. 10mA) and brightness rating (9mcd vs. 29mcd), with an expanded viewing angle (80° vs. 60°). Both parts are ROHS3 compliant and REACH unaffected.

Engineering Selection Recommendations

For Direct Replacement: The Dialight 5510507F is the primary substitute for the obsolete 5510507. Both parts are from the same manufacturer, maintain identical electrical and optical specifications, and share the same mechanical form factor. The 5510507F carries active product status and ROHS3 compliance certification, making it suitable for new designs and ongoing production support.

For Alternative Sourcing: The Lumex Opto/Components Inc. SSF-LXH103ID-5V serves as a functional alternative when the direct Dialight equivalent is unavailable. This part meets the core voltage and mounting requirements with compatible wavelength and lens characteristics. The increased current consumption (12mA vs. 10mA) and reduced brightness (9mcd vs. 29mcd) must be evaluated against circuit design constraints. The expanded viewing angle (80° vs. 60°) may provide operational advantages in certain applications. Both substitute options carry ROHS3 compliance and REACH unaffected status.

Frequently Asked Questions (FAQ)

Q: Can the 5510507F be used as a direct drop-in replacement for the 5510507?

A: Yes. The 5510507F maintains identical electrical specifications (5V, 10mA), optical output (29mcd at 635nm), viewing angle (60°), and mechanical form factor (3mm T-1 through-hole, right-angle mount). The parts are functionally equivalent and mechanically compatible.

Q: What are the key differences between the Dialight 5510507F and the Lumex SSF-LXH103ID-5V?

A: The primary differences are brightness (29mcd vs. 9mcd), current consumption (10mA vs. 12mA), and viewing angle (60° vs. 80°). Both parts share the same voltage rating (5V), wavelength (635nm), lens type (diffused, tinted), and mounting configuration (3mm T-1 through-hole, right-angle). The Lumex part draws 2mA additional current and provides a wider viewing angle with lower brightness output.

Q: Are both substitute parts ROHS3 compliant?

A: Yes. The Dialight 5510507F and Lumex SSF-LXH103ID-5V are both ROHS3 compliant. Both parts are REACH unaffected and carry EAR99 export classification.

Q: What is the impact of the 12mA current requirement in the Lumex part versus the 10mA specification of the original?

A: The 2mA increase in current consumption must be evaluated within the context of the circuit's power budget and current-limiting resistor design. The higher current draw may require circuit recalculation to maintain proper LED operation and lifespan.

Q: Does the reduced brightness of the Lumex part (9mcd vs. 29mcd) affect visibility?

A: The Lumex part provides approximately one-third the brightness of the original specification. Application suitability depends on the intended use case, ambient lighting conditions, and visibility requirements. The expanded 80° viewing angle may partially offset the reduced brightness in certain mounting orientations.

Q: Are the mechanical dimensions identical between all three parts?

A: Yes. All three parts feature 3mm T-1 form factor with round domed top lens, diffused tinted appearance, and through-hole right-angle mounting. The mechanical footprint and PCB hole spacing are compatible across all options.
